Are you in the mood for some Mega Performers at the 2023 VMA’s?
Fall Out Boy, Metro Boomin with Future, A Boogie Wit da Hoodie. Swae Lee & NAV. And Peso Pluma add even greater star power to the roster of global music stars set to perform at the 2023 “VMAs.” LIVE from New Jersey’s Prudential Center on Tuesday, September 12th at 8 PM ET/PT.
The 2023 “VMAs” will air on 13th September on MTV UK and Pluto TV with the pre-show at 9 pm. Followed by the main show at 10:30 pm and on Paramount+ on 19th September.

FALL OUT BOY
The 3x Moon Person winners are set to light up the stage at the upcoming “VMAs.” The multi-platinum rock group first electrified the stage with “Sugar. We’re Goin’ Down” (2005) and again two years later with “Shut Up And Drive” featuring Rihanna and “Thnks Fr Th Mmrs” (2007). Boasting an impressive 16 “VMAs” nods overall, the band will look to add to their trophy collection. With nominations for “Best Visual Effects” and “Best Alternative” from their 8th studio album So Much (For) Stardust, which debuted as the No. 1 Rock album upon its March 24 release. The band is currently on their worldwide So Much For (Tour) Dust headline tour. And most recently announced So Much For (2our) Dust, an additional 20+ date run across the United States beginning February 2024.
METRO BOOMIN FT FUTURE, A BOOGIE WIT DA HOODIE, SWAE LEE & NAV
Diamond-certified artist & producer Metro Boomin will mark his first-ever “VMAs” performance with the broadcast debut of his two hit singles “Superhero (Heroes & Villains)” with Future and “Calling” with A Boogie Wit da Hoodie, Swae Lee and NAV and on stage together for the first time ever. The first-time “VMAs” nominee is up for 4x awards this year. Including “Album of the Year,” “Best Hip-Hop” for “Superhero (Heroes and Villains)” with Future.
PESO PLUMA
With the biggest música Mexicana album “Genesis” of all time. Plus multiple chart-topping songs and collaborations, Peso Pluma continues to forge a path of historic milestones in music. Recently receiving the pinnacle spot on Spotify’s Global Songs of the Summer list for the single “Ella Baila Sola” with Eslabon Armado, this accomplished singer and songwriter will next take the stage for his inaugural “VMAs” performance and compete for his first Moon Person, contending in three distinguished categories: “Best New Artist,” “Best Latin” and “Song of the Summer.”
